Research On The Electrogastric Parameters And Autonomic Nervous Function In Patients With Type 2 Diabetes Mellitus Complicated With Gastroesophageal Reflux Disease

Objective: To investigate whether patients with type 2 diabetes and gastroesophageal reflux disease have characteristic gastric electrical activity and heart rate variability,and explore the role of type 2 diabetes autonomic nerve function and gastric emptying in the occurrence of gastroesophageal reflux disease.Methods: 1.Select patients from our department of endocrinology from January 2019 to May 2019,select 28 patients in type 2 diabetes group as test group1;21 patients in type 2 diabetes with gastroesophageal reflux group as test group 2;26 healthy volunteers were normal controls.All subjects included in the group had gastrointestinal endoscopy to exclude gastrointestinal organic diseases.2.Collect general clinical data and diabetes-related data of all study subjects;The three groups of subjects underwent pre-prandial and post-prandial electrocardiogram and heart rate variability examinations.3.Chi-square test is used for counting data comparison;independent sample t test is used for measuring data comparison;the single-factor analysis of variance was used to analyze the differences between the electrocardiogram indicators and the heart rate variability parameters of each group,and the two groups were compared LSD test was used;Pearson correlation was used to analyze the correlation between electrocardiogram indexes and heart rate variability parameters.Results:1.The differences in drinking history and body mass index(BMI)between trial 1 and trial 2 were statistically significant(P<0.05),but gender and smoking history were not statistically significant(P> 0.05).2.There was a statistically significant difference in the glycated hemoglobin,duration of diabetes,fasting blood glucose,and 2h postprandial blood glucose in the test 1 and test 2 groups(P <0.05).3.The comparison of the ratio of normal slow wave rhythm before meal and after meal,the ratio of premature and postprandial gastric dysrhythmia,and the ratio of premeal gastric electrical tachycardia in the three groups(P <0.05);In the pairwise comparison,the ratio of the normal slow-wave rhythm after meal in the trial 1 group was lower than that in the normal group,but the proportion of postprandial gastric tachycardia was higher than that in the normal group;The ratio of normal slow-wave rhythm after meal was lower than that of normal group,but the ratio of premature and postprandial gastrointestinal motility and the rate of premeditated gastric motility were higher than normal group;of the comparison between test 1 and test 2,test 2 The normal pre-prandial slow-wave rhythm ratio was lower than that in trial group 1,but the proportion of pre-prandial gastric motility and the proportion of pre-prandial gastric motility in trial 2 group were higher than those in trial 1 group.4.Comparison of autonomic nerve activity,high-frequency power,and low-frequency power of the three groups of patients was statistically significant(P <0.05);in the pairwise comparison between the two groups,the autonomic nerve activity,high frequency of test 1 and test 2 groups The power and low-frequency power were lower than those in the normal group;compared with the test 1 group and the test 2 group,the autonomic activity,high-frequency power indexes of the test 2 group were lower than that of the test 1 group.5.The proportion of normal slow-wave rhythm in the correlation between autonomic nerve function changes and gastric electrical rhythm disorders was positively correlated with autonomic activity,low-frequency power,and high-frequency power.Conclusion: 1.The occurrence of gastroesophageal reflux in type 1 and type 2 diabetes is related to the course of diabetes,HbAlc,FPG,2hPG,BMI and drinking history.2.Type 2 diabetes has a decrease in the proportion of normal gastric slow waves,and an increase in the proportion of hyperkinesis and bradykinetics,leading to gastric emptying disorders,which may be one of the reasons for gastroesophageal reflux.3.Type 2 diabetes mellitus with gastroesophageal reflux is more obvious than that of simple diabetes.4.Type 2 diabetes has autonomic dysfunction,which is positively correlated with disturbance of gastric electrical rhythm.
